I lost the key to my car. can i change it to where it works with a different key?
you would need to replace the ignition switch and the door locks, it will cost you quite a bit probably.

Reply:okay a much less costly option would be to have a locksmith make you new keys.
Reply:Major changes to your doors and ignition seems silly. Spend $25 dollars and call a locksmith they will even drive out to your car and cut a key right there on the spot.
Reply:yes you can and the cost depends on the car it start off usually about 65 bucks per lock and goes up but usually you can rekey your locks call your local locksmith and it does take a little time some times you may hav to replace the ignition but it depends on the car
